OrderSend() function is the gateway between your Expert Advisor and the trade server. Despite being one of the most frequently used MQL4 functions, its proper implementation remains widely misunderstood. Poor error handling and execution logic are responsible for 70% of EA runtime failures.Function Signature and Return Values
``
cpp
int OrderSend(string symbol, int cmd, double volume, double price,
int slippage, double stoploss, double takeprofit,
string comment, int magic, datetime expiration,
color arrow_color);
`
Return value: ticket number (>=0) on success, -1 on failure with GetLastError() providing the error code.
Systematic Error Handling Framework
Every OrderSend() call must be wrapped with retry logic. Never assume first-attempt success.
`cpp
// MQL4 - Production-ready OrderSend with retry and error classification
int OrderSendWithRetry(string sym, int cmd, double vol, double price,
int slip, double sl, double tp, string cmt,
int magic, datetime exp) {
int attempt = 0;
int maxAttempts = 3;
int ticket = -1;
while(attempt < maxAttempts) {
attempt++;
RefreshRates();
ticket = OrderSend(sym, cmd, vol, price, slip, sl, tp, cmt, magic, exp, clrNONE);
int error = GetLastError();
if(ticket > 0) {
return ticket;
}
// Error classification and recovery
switch(error) {
case 129: // Invalid price
case 136: // Off quotes
case 138: // Requote
Sleep(100 attempt); // Exponential backoff
price = NormalizeDouble(MarketInfo(sym, MODE_ASK), Digits);
break;
case 146: // Trading context busy
Sleep(150 attempt);
while(IsTradeContextBusy()) Sleep(50);
break;
case 148: // Too many orders
return -1; // Immediate failure
default:
Print("OrderSend error ", error, " on attempt ", attempt);
Sleep(100);
}
}
return -1;
}
`
Slippage Calculation Models
Slippage parameter accepts values in points. The actual execution price deviation is:
\[
\Delta p_{\text{actual}} = |p_{\text{requested}} - p_{\text{executed}}| \leq \text{slippage} \times \text{Point}
\]
For aggressive execution, use dynamic slippage based on volatility:
`cpp
int DynamicSlippage() {
double spread = MarketInfo(Symbol(), MODE_SPREAD);
double atr = iATR(NULL, 0, 14, 1);
double volatilitySlippage = MathMax(spread, atr / Point * 0.05);
return (int)MathMin(volatilitySlippage, 50);
}
`
Pending Order Modification Logic
Market orders use price = Ask/Bid. Pending orders require specific price calculations:
Buy Limit: price below current Ask
Buy Stop: price above current Ask
Sell Limit: price above current Bid
Sell Stop: price below current Bid
Distance verification formula:
\[
d = |p_{\text{order}} - p_{\text{current}}| \geq \text{StopLevel} \times \text{Point}
\]
Always validate with MarketInfo(symbol, MODE_STOPLEVEL)` before sending.Error Code Reference for Production
